Display
Display type
IPS
The type of technology used in the display.
response time
0.5 ms
Response time is how long it takes for a display to change the state of pixels, in order to show new content. The less time it takes to respond, the less likely it is to blur fast-changing images.
screen size
23.8"
The size of the screen (measured diagonally).
resolution
1920 x 1080 px
Resolution is an essential indicator of a screen's image quality, representing the maximum amount of pixels that can be shown on the screen. The resolution is given as a compound value, comprised of horizontal and vertical pixels.
pixel density
Pixel density is a measurement of a screen's resolution, expressed as the number of pixels per inch (PPI) on the screen. A higher pixel density translates into more clarity and sharpness for the images rendered on the screen, thus improving the quality of the viewing experience.
Adaptive synchronization
None
The type of adaptive synchronization technology supported.
has anti-glare coating
✖AOC 24G4 24"
Anti-glare helps to reduce the external reflections of light coming from outside the display.
refresh rate
180Hz
The frequency at which the display is refreshed (1 Hz = once per second). A higher refresh rate results in smoother UI animations and video playback.
maximum horizontal viewing angle
178º
Horizontal viewing angle is the maximum angle at which a display can be viewed with acceptable visual performance.

Colors
brightness (typical)
300 nits
A nit is a measurement of the light that a display emits, equal to one candela per square meter. Brighter displays ensure a screen's contents are easy to read, even in sunny conditions.
supports color calibration
✖AOC 24G4 24"
A properly calibrated screen represents colors as they are and i.e. you can conduct a photo shoot while verifying your photos in real time. An internal sensor and/or colorimeter is usually included for trouble-free calibration.
display colors
16.7 million
Number of colors that a display can accurately reproduce.
bit depth
Unknown. Help us by suggesting a value.
Bit depth is the number of bits used to indicate the color of a single pixel. The more bits, the more color range a panel displays. An 8-bit panel uses 256 levels per channel and displays 16.7 million colors, while a 10-bit one reaches 1024 and displays 1.07 billion colors.
contrast ratio
1000:1
Contrast ratio is the visual distance between the lightest and the darkest colors that may be reproduced on the display. A high contrast ratio is desired, resulting in richer dark colors and more distinctive color gradation.
